Understanding the Two Main Humidifier Technologies
Cool mist humidifiers split into two common designs, each adding moisture without changing air temperature. Ultrasonic models vibrate a metal diaphragm at high frequency to break water into an ultra-fine room-temperature mist, while evaporative units pull air through a saturated wick filter so humidity leaves the device at ambient temperature. Either form fits spaces already heated to a comfortable level, since neither adds warmth to the room.
Warm mist humidifiers, often called steam vaporizers, contain a heating element that brings water close to boiling. The steam rises, cools a few degrees in the housing, and exits as a visible warm vapor. Honeywell, Vicks, and Crane all sell steam-based units in this category, and many include a small medicine cup for menthol inhalants during cold season.
Why the Mechanism Change Matters for Daily Use
Boiling water draws more electricity than vibrating a diaphragm or pulling air through a wick. A typical warm mist unit pulls between 200 and 350 watts, while most ultrasonic cool mist models run on 20 to 40 watts. That gap adds up on monthly power bills when the unit runs eight or more hours per day through a dry winter.
Tip: Check the wattage label on the back or base of any unit you compare. A 300-watt warm mist running 10 hours a day adds roughly 9 kWh to your bill per week, while a 30-watt ultrasonic adds under 1 kWh.
Health, Safety, and Comfort Trade-Offs to Weigh
Safety around children and pets is the single biggest reason families default to cool mist. Warm mist units heat water to near boiling, and the internal reservoir plus the steam outlet can scald a curious hand. The American Academy of Pediatrics has long noted that any appliance producing hot steam or hot water poses a burn risk in a nursery, which is why pediatric guidance generally favors cool mist for infants and toddlers.
Warm mist does offer a measurable comfort benefit during a cold. The heated vapor can soothe irritated nasal passages and loosen chest congestion, and the internal boiling process kills some bacteria and mold spores before the water ever leaves the unit. If anyone in your home deals with recurring sinus pressure or spends January battling a head cold, that warmth factor may tip the balance toward steam.
Mineral Dust, Microbial Growth, and the 30–50% Range
Cool mist units, especially ultrasonic models, can aerosolize the calcium and magnesium already dissolved in tap water. Those minerals settle as a fine white dust on nightstands, electronics, and crib rails, and in sensitive lungs they can aggravate asthma or allergies. Levoit and AprilAire both recommend distilled water for ultrasonic units for exactly this reason. The EPA and ASHRAE both suggest keeping indoor relative humidity between 30% and 50% to suppress mold growth and dust mite activity without drying out your skin and sinuses.

Matching Humidifier Type to Room Size, Climate, and Season
Cool mist evaporative and ultrasonic models generally cover more square footage than compact warm mist units. A mid-size ultrasonic can comfortably humidify 400 to 500 square feet, while many warm mist tabletop models top out around 250 square feet. If you’re trying to condition an open living area or a finished basement, that capacity gap decides the question for you.
Climate matters just as much as room size. Hot, arid regions like the desert Southwest see summer humidity drop below 15% indoors once the air conditioner runs nonstop, and a warm mist unit would add unwanted heat. Cool mist is the better fit there. In a New England winter, the heated vapor from a warm mist unit feels more comforting in a chilly bedroom, and the extra energy cost is partly offset because the steam adds a small amount of warmth to the room.
Seasonal Rotation and Tank Capacity
Some households keep two units and rotate them, warm mist from November through March for bedroom comfort, then cool mist for the dry air-conditioned months from May through September. A larger tank in the 4 to 6 liter range means longer run time between refills, which matters if you’re running the unit through an entire work-from-home day. Bedrooms, nurseries, and finished basements each have different ideal tank sizes, and matching capacity to the room prevents the constant refilling that turns a helpful appliance into an annoyance.
Energy Use, Cleaning, and Long-Term Ownership Costs
Cool mist humidifiers typically use less electricity because they don’t heat water to boiling. Over a full winter of nightly use, the gap can reach 100 kWh or more between the two types, which translates to a real dollar difference on utility bills. The trade-off is that cool mist evaporative models carry a wick filter that needs replacement every one to three months, and that filter cost adds up over the life of the unit.
Warm mist units usually require less frequent deep cleaning because the internal heating process keeps the water path relatively free of microbial growth. Cool mist reservoirs, especially if you skip daily rinses, can develop biofilm or mold within a week, and ASTM testing standards for household humidifiers all recommend daily tank rinsing and weekly descaling with white vinegar or a manufacturer-approved solution.
White Dust, Distilled Water, and Filter Expense
If you notice a chalky film on furniture within a few days of running an ultrasonic unit, that’s mineral dust, and the fix is straightforward. Switch to distilled water at about $1 per gallon at most grocery stores and the dust disappears almost entirely. For households that don’t want to buy jugs of water, an evaporative cool mist unit sidesteps the issue by trapping minerals in the wick filter. Factor in roughly $30 to $60 per year for replacement wicks or demineralization cartridges when you budget the long-term cost of either type.
Those recurring filter expenses quickly shift which unit makes sense once a household runs the machine around the clock.
Choosing the Right Type for Babies, Allergies, and Specific Health Needs
Pediatric guidance generally favors cool mist in nurseries because there is no hot water or steam surface to touch, and because cool mist can run for hours without raising the room temperature into an uncomfortable range. If your baby is congested, a Vicks warm mist unit placed on a high shelf out of reach can help, but most pediatricians still recommend cool mist as the default for overnight nursery use.
For adults with allergies or asthma, the decision gets more nuanced. Cool mist adds the moisture that calms irritated airways, but ultrasonic mineral dust can actually trigger symptoms in sensitive lungs. An evaporative cool mist unit, or a warm mist unit with regular cleaning, often strikes a better balance for allergy sufferers. People with cold and flu congestion frequently report that warm mist feels more soothing, which lines up with the heated-vapor comfort factor mentioned earlier.
Dry Skin, Sinus Pressure, and Sensitive Household Members
Dry skin and nighttime sinus irritation respond well to either type, as long as you stay within the 30% to 50% humidity range. If you or anyone in your home bleeds easily from dry nasal passages in winter, cool mist is the safer default because it adds moisture without any burn risk. When a household includes both a baby and an adult with chronic sinus issues, the cool mist evaporative style usually wins because it handles the nursery safely and avoids the mineral dust problem that can bother sensitive adult airways.
A Simple Decision Framework for Buying With Confidence
Start with safety, especially if children, pets, or elderly relatives share the space. That single factor usually points to cool mist as the default for family homes, because no hot water or steam surface removes the scald risk entirely. From there, factor in room size, climate, and whether the unit will run year-round or only in winter.
Account for noise tolerance in bedrooms, your willingness to clean the unit every few days, and your budget for filters and distilled water. Test the room’s humidity with an inexpensive hygrometer in the $10 to $15 range and aim to stay within the 30% to 50% range the EPA recommends. Hygrometers also tell you when the unit is oversized, since pushing past 60% encourages mold growth and condensation on windows.

Are cool mist humidifiers safer than warm mist?
Yes. Cool mist units produce room-temperature vapor, so there is no hot water or steam surface to scald a hand. Warm mist units boil water internally and release heated steam, which is the main burn risk in homes with curious toddlers or pets.
Do warm mist humidifiers kill bacteria?
Boiling water reduces some bacteria and mold spores in the reservoir, but it does not sterilize the air in the room. The unit still needs regular cleaning, because biofilm can form on the heating element and other internal surfaces over time.

Do cool mist humidifiers make the room cold?
Not noticeably. Ultrasonic and evaporative units release vapor at roughly the room’s existing temperature, so the air feels neutral or very slightly cooler in dry conditions. In a heated home, the effect on room temperature is minimal over an eight-hour run.
Can you use essential oils in a cool mist humidifier?
Only if the manufacturer explicitly approves it. Standard ultrasonic diaphragms can be damaged by oils, and aerosolized oil droplets may irritate lungs or bother pets, especially cats. Use a separate diffuser designed for oils if you want both functions in the same room.
